As of May 2024 The Cross-Harbour Holdings has a market cap of $0.34 Billion. This makes The Cross-Harbour Holdings the world's 6412th most valuable company by market cap according to our data. The market capitalization, commonly called market cap, is the total market value of a publicly traded company's outstanding shares and is commonly used to measure how much a company is worth.
